MLC's New Zealand manager Andrew Kuruc has been transferred back to head office in Sydney following the proposed merger of MLC's parent company Lend Lease and National Mutual.
The two groups have agreed to merge their life insurance and funds management operations in Australia and New Zealand.
Kuruc is still responsible for MLC's products in New Zealand, however that role will be taken over by National Mutual's Jill Paterson later in the year.
Kuruc says with the merger it made sense that the two operations in New Zealand were combined.

He says the Australian funds offered by MLC in New Zealand will continue to carry the MLC name.
